Things to do in Mae Chaem

Nestled in the mountains, Mae Chaem boasts breathtaking landscapes featuring lush forests and serene lakes. Travelers can explore scenic hiking trails, enjoy birdwatching, or relax by tranquil waters. This charming destination offers a perfect blend of outdoor activities and natural beauty, making it an ideal getaway for nature enthusiasts.

  • Phra Mahathat Noppamethanedon and Phra Mahathat NopphonphusiriOpens in a new window – Visit this impressive monument, where the stunning architecture and serene surroundings create a peaceful atmosphere. Enjoy the bre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ains and natural parks, making it a perfect spot for photography enthusiasts.
  • Wat Phra That Si Chom ThongOpens in a new window – Explore this beautiful temple, known for its intricate designs and spiritual significance. As you wander the grounds, take in the tranquil ambiance and discover the rich history that echoes through its walls.
  • Doi InthanonOpens in a new window – Venture to Thailand's highest mountain, where you can hike through lush trails and witness the diverse flora and fauna. Climb to the summit for stunning panoramic views that will leave you in awe of nature's beauty.
  • Mae Ya WaterfallOpens in a new window – Make your way to this spectacular waterfall, where the cascading waters create a mesmerizing sight. Spend some time relaxing by the pool at the base or take a refreshing dip to escape the heat.
  • Mae Klang WaterfallOpens in a new window – Discover this charming waterfall, surrounded by lush greenery. It's a delightful spot for a picnic or simply to enjoy the soothing sounds of flowing water while you take in the natural beauty around you.

Best time to go to Mae Chaem

Mae Chaem experiences its lowest average temperature in December, at 71.1°F (21.7°C), while April is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 86.5°F (30.3°C). September is typically the wettest month. If you’re looking to soak up the lively atmosphere in Mae Chaem, October to December are the peak months to visit, bustling with fellow travelers. During this peak period, the weather is sunny to mostly sunny, with little to no rainfall. However, if you prefer a more relaxed experience, March to May are perfect for a quieter getaway, marked by no to light rainfall and sunny to mostly sunny conditions.
